Kyung-In Museum of Fine Art
Kyung-In Museum of Fine Art is a private art institution in Seoul dedicated to Korean and East Asian visual arts. The museum exhibits contemporary paintings, sculptures, prints, and ceramics, with a focus on mid-to-contemporary Korean artists. Its rotating exhibitions present diverse artistic movements and techniques, from traditional ink painting to modern abstract work. The intimate gallery spaces allow close engagement with artworks, while the museum's collection reflects Korea's artistic heritage and contemporary creative landscape. Regular exhibitions and educational programming make it a resource for both art enthusiasts and casual visitors exploring Seoul's art scene.
